Scope
This standard specifies a method for simulating the formation of deposits on intake valves of gasoline engines and the determination of the amount of deposits produced. This standard is applicable to the qualitative detection of whether automotive gasoline contains detergents. Qualitative testing of whether specific detergents containing amine type or polyether ammonia dispersants, polyether carrier agents, etc. are added to automotive gasoline can be carried out according to Appendix A.
